#3c1432 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3c1432 is composed of 23.5% red, 7.8%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.7% magenta, 16.7% yellow and 76.5% black. It has a hue angle of 315 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 15.7%. #3c1432 color hex could be obtained by blending #782864 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#3c1432

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#faf1f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3c1432

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2a2629 is the less saturated color, while #4e023b is the most saturated one.
